ShenGo Posted March 5, 2019 Posted March 5, 2019 I noticed a weird glitch with the animated skin, where any changes made to the body in race menu cause the body to clip through the bodysuit. The armor itself responds to the .tri files, but the bodysuit underneath the armor doesn't, so if, say, I increase the size of her chest in-game, the writing disappears on her chest. How can I fix that? Btw, I tried using it without the race menu morphs (the .tri files) but had the same problem, even though the nifs appear to include a body. It's as if it lays OVER my body instead of replacing it, though that doesn't explain why the armor responds to the tri files but the bodysuit doesn't even though they're there same nif. I'm quite confused lol.

Dang, that's exactly what I did... I guess I'll try reinstalling completely... >.< Edit: Before reinstalling, I decided to investigate a bit more. It turned out that somehow, the .nif files were pointing to the wrong .tri files. I changed the string index to look for the .tri files of the correct name and now they work like a charm. I'm not sure how I ended up with such a silly issue, but I got it resolved. Thanks!

C5Kev Posted April 6, 2019 Author Posted April 6, 2019 I'll assume you did this... " For CBBE People - If converting one of my mods, select nif's from the "Data\CalienteTools\BodySlide\ShapeData" directory ". The animation is handled within the nif files. With a conversion, the nif's don't change per se, only the "size" and the reference body does. Therefore, you had to have done "something" that changed the nifs and naturally, I'd have no idea what that is. Sorry I can't be of more assistance and can only suggest that you try it again.
